Как сделать так, чтобы окно диалога показывалось только для игрока, который, собственно, создал игру?

Можно перейти на UjAPI и просто воспользоваться нативкой:
native GetHostPlayer takes nothing returns player

Или подождать адептов мемхака...
`
ОЖИДАНИЕ РЕКЛАМЫ...

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
6
Пишешь событие, которое тебе нужно, например, "Игрок пишет "-Диалог" (точное совпадение)
И в условии ставишь "Имя игрока = твой ник"
1
Пишешь событие, которое тебе нужно, например, "Игрок пишет "-Диалог" (точное совпадение)
И в условии ставишь "Имя игрока = твой ник"
Нет, вы немного не поняли. Я имею в виду, как определить человека, который запустил карту в локальной сети? В начале игры должен выходить диалог и появляться только для хоста игры.
Этот комментарий удален
30
Можно перейти на UjAPI и просто воспользоваться нативкой:
native GetHostPlayer takes nothing returns player

Или подождать адептов мемхака...
Принятый ответ
32
nazarpunk, насколько помню, по геймкешу и зажержке синха, без мемхака, способ не очень надежный.
19
по геймкешу и зажержке синха, без мемхака, способ не очень надежный.
Скорее, совершенно нерабочий, ведь обработка сетевых команд (синк кэша, приказ юнитам...) и симуляция игрового мира у всех игроков проходит одинаково, а иначе была бы десинхронизация.
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.